Biography
Patti Smith is an American singer, songwriter, poet, and artist whose career has been closely identified with the Patti Smith Group. Born in Chicago, Illinois, in 1946, she came to prominence from 1971 onward with work that bridged rock music, poetry, and performance art.
Her songs and writing have been associated with rock, proto-punk, post-punk, art rock, garage rock, glam rock, punk rock, and pop rock. Alongside vocals, she is linked to guitar and clarinet, and her wider creative work extends into writing, visual art, photography, and film direction.
Smith’s catalog includes the influential Horses, released in 1975, as well as later albums such as Dream of Life, Gone Again, Peace and Noise, Gung Ho, Trampin’, Banga, and several releases from the 2010s and 2020s.
